Covid Absence Update: 30/01/2023
Current guidance advises isolation and absence due to testing positive for Covid is 5 days for adults and 3 days for children as long as they are well enough for school.
This starts from the day after you did the test. If a child or young person aged 18 or under tests positive for COVID-19, they should try to stay at home and avoid contact with other people for 3 days. This starts from the day after they did the test. Children and young people tend to be infectious to others for less time than adults. If they’re well and do not have a temperature after 3 days, there’s a much lower risk that they’ll pass on COVID-19 to others.
